Founded in 1893 Dulwich Hamlet Football Club is one of the oldest non league football teams in the London Metropolitan area. After enjoying much success in their early days and prior to the Second World War, regularly attracting several thousand to their Champion Hill Stadium even for reserve team games, the club fell into decline from the 1960s as the amateur game was left behind. However in recent years there has been a resurgence of interest in grassroots football with Dulwich Hamlet one of the main beneficiaries. From crowds of less than 300 at games the support has grown to such an extent that the last home match of 2014-2015 was declared All Ticket, a first for the club, as 3000 packed into Champion Hill to watch a 0-0 draw with Maidstone United. That growth has been driven by a variety of factors from a ticket pricing designed to attract the new young support whilst rewarding the long term die-hards to Community initiatives on the part of the Club's Committee tackling issues such as Racism, Homophobia and Mental Health.
